First up, the Summits. VERY big in person - WIDE, too! Much larger stator panel relative to the Vantage! Also, the cabinet was a good 2x in volume larger! The Summits played wide, loud, and beautifully! The extension was there, the midrange was present in spades, and the bass (with the Descent turned off) was tactile yet transient... perrrrrfect! We listened to all sorts of songs - from Mariah Carrey to Norah Jones to 50 cent to 3 Doors Down to Eagles.

Next up, I hooked up the Vantage.

"Please God.. please make the Vantage sound halfway as good as the Summits or I'll end up spending $10,000 on speakers...."

First note..... boom! Vocals, midrange, highs, treble, and even the bass was eeriely (sp?) similar to that of the Summits. The Summits had better bass - no doubt - but all above a certain frequency sounded very similar from the sweet spot. The Summits were CRAZY overall... very good depth in soundstage while remaining uncongested and airy throughout the musical reproduction! At times, I felt that speakers were too good for what I was playing through them.... I felt the need for better recordings!

The Vantage were also CRAZY overall! Far better than when I auditioned at the other Tweeter store! There was no recessed vocal/midrange - everything came through loud and clear. The imaging was precise, the stage extended beyond the panels - both in width and in depth.... the bass was quick, fast, and wickedly good! Keep in mind that I was in a large 20x20 room - and the bass was good enough for me to say that I wont be missing my subwoofer (I have to sell so I can buy the Vantage) in the meantime... until I can afford to augment it with a better SVS or the Descent.

Just like those of use who have auditioned both the Summit and Vantage have stated:

  • The panels and their music reproduction are very similar in quality.
  • The bass between the two is different as one would expect with two drivers and larger encloser in the Summit, and only one driver (smaller) in the Vantage
  • Vantage is 1/2 the price of a Summit, but in regards to cost versus performance is more around the range of 3/4 of the Summit.
  • Costs saved on the Vantage (and great price you have there on 20% off), can be used for better associated gear and music for your system.
